Another way to manage full service moving prices is to understand what’s included in the quote. Some companies offer all-inclusive packages, while others charge separately for each service. Always ask for a detailed breakdown to avoid surprises on moving day.In conclusion, while full-service moving can be costly, the convenience and peace of mind it offers are often worth the investment.
